Oxidation number of $\mathrm{S}$ involved in coordination bond in $\mathrm{Na}_{2} \mathrm{~S}_{2} \mathrm{O}_{3}$ is
  1. $-2$
  2. $+2$
  3. $+5$
  4. $+6$

Solution

\(\mathrm{Na}^{+} \mathrm{O}^{-}-\underset{|| \atop \huge \stackrel{ }{\mathrm{O}}}{\stackrel{\huge \mathrm{S} \atop \uparrow}{\mathrm{S}}}-\mathrm{O}^{-} \mathrm{Na}^{+}\) There is a coordinate bond between two sulphur atoms. The oxidation number of acceptor \(\mathrm{S}\)-atom is -2. Let, the oxidation number of other \(\mathrm{S}\)-atom be \(\mathrm{x}\). \(\underset{\text { For } \mathrm{Na}}{2(+1)}+\underset{\text { For catoms }}{3 \times(-2)}+x+\underset{\text { For coordinate S-atoms }}{1(-2)}=0\) \(x=+6\) *
